Despite a rough history: US national coach Gregg Berhalter is again relying on Giovanni Reyna from Borussia Dortmund with a view to the World Cup in his own country. This is not a given – the conflict surrounding the 2022 World Cup in Qatar almost cost the coach his job.

Gregg Berhalter clearly doesn’t hold grudges, even if he has every reason to. After all, he had been unemployed for six months because a bizarre and reputation-damaging dispute with Giovanni Reyna’s parents temporarily cost him his job as the USA’s national soccer coach. Only the independent investigation into a long-cleared incident from 1991, in which he had actually kicked his current wife, led to Berhalter’s reinstatement in June.

As the former Bundesliga professional, his squad for the international matches against Germany in Hartford (9 p.m. CEST/RTL and in the live ticker on ntv.de) and four days later against Ghana in Nashville, Reyna was definitely there. And a few days ago, Berhalter reported, they also spoke in private. “Our intentions are positive,” said the 50-year-old, “we both want to work together so that the team is successful and we are ready to do so.”

Given the history, this was not necessarily to be expected. When it became known after the World Cup in Qatar that Berhalter had almost sent the demonstratively listless Reyna home, his parents stepped into the picture. Mother Danielle denounced Berhalter to the US association. It was about a case from the current couple’s student days, Berhalter and Reyna: In 1991, Berhalter kicked his current wife Rosalind while drunk, and Danielle Reyna even claims that he “beat the shit” out of her.

Berhalter’s contract was initially not extended by the US association, but the investigation led to a completely different result than the Reynas had expected. Berhalter and his wife had long since dealt with the incident with professional help, and it also emerged that Reyna’s father Claudio, once a Bundesliga professional in Wolfsburg and Leverkusen, had been putting the US association under massive pressure since 2016. Above all, he constantly attacked coaches and those in charge when his son allegedly didn’t play enough.

So it’s no wonder that Berhalter now said that “it takes time” to repair the relationship, at least with Giovanni Reyna. In terms of sport, the midfielder is hardly up for discussion. He proved how important Reyna can be for the US national team in June, when the USA won the CONCACAF Nations League thanks to his direction. The interim coach at this time was BJ Callaghan. Berhalter only took over after the Gold Cup in July, for which Reyna was injured.

If Reyna is fit and in shape, he will of course be nominated, Berhalter assured. The fact that, after six months of uncertainty, he will now remain coach of the USA until the 2026 World Cup is thanks not least to influential players. Former Dortmund player Christian Pulisic in particular campaigned more or less directly for Berhalter to be entrusted with the task again.

With a view to building a team for the home World Cup, Berhalter has called up numerous players for the upcoming international matches who had or have connections to Germany. Because no players from clubs from the North American Major League Soccer were nominated due to the play-offs just beginning, Lennard Maloney from newly promoted Bundesliga club 1. FC Heidenheim is in the squad for the first time.
